Purple Highlights

Mixing violet with a warm white — this white has a little bit of orange in it, so it’s going to keep the purple highlight desaturated. We’re going to kick this up pretty far.

The approach here is layering at glaze consistency — maybe a little thicker than a true glaze. We’re hitting a bit less area than the last pass. The plan is:

  1. Layer up the purple highlights
  2. Take it one more step brighter
  3. Glaze over that to smooth it out
  4. One final edge highlight round

He’s drying out a bit, so I’m grabbing some more of this white. At this point I can do a little overlapping since we’re definitely at glaze consistency.

On the back part here, I’m grabbing pure white and just edge highlighting the very tip-top edges. One more glaze round after I let all this fully dry and settle — it’s still wet right now.
